IIRC QEMU also uses > PHYSDEVOP_{un,}map_pirq in order to allocate MSI(-X) interrupts. I'll let Ray reply here, but I think you are right: HYSDEVOP_{un,}map_pirq are needed so that QEMU can run in PVH Dom0 to support HVM guests.
